Embodiment 1
[0039] refer to figure 1 , the invention discloses a Type-C power supply method, which is applied to supply power to peripheral devices, and mainly includes the following steps:
[0040] The adapter supplies power to the DC-DC module through the first socket, so that the DC-DC module outputs the first voltage to the PD control module;
[0041] The first female seat sends the received electrical signal fed back by the PD control module to the adapter so that the adapter negotiates with the PD control module and enables the adapter to output the first power;
[0042] The PD control module obtains the required voltage of the peripheral through negotiation, and the PD power supply module receives the peripheral required voltage fed back by the PD control module, and determines whether the required voltage of the peripheral is greater than or equal to the first threshold;

Embodiment 2
[0061] On the basis of Embodiment 1, the present invention also discloses a Type-C power supply method, which is applied to peripheral power supply, including:
[0062] After receiving the first voltage input by the DC-DC module, the PD control module feeds back an electrical signal to the first socket, and negotiates with the PD adapter through the first socket so that the adapter connected to the first socket outputs the first power; the The DC-DC module is powered by the first socket connected to the adapter, and the DC-DC module outputs the first voltage after working;
[0063] The PD control module obtains the peripheral demand voltage through the negotiation of the second socket, and feeds back the peripheral demand voltage to the PD power supply module, so that the PD power supply module judges whether the peripheral demand voltage is greater than or equal to the first threshold,

Embodiment 3
[0073] refer to figure 2 , the present invention discloses a Type-C power supply device, which uses the power supply method of Embodiment 1 or 2 for power supply, including: adapter, first female seat, second female seat, PD control module, PD power supply module, DC-DC module, mainboard power supply module, system mainboard and Bypass circuit.
[0074] The first port of the first female seat is connected to the adapter, the second port of the first female seat is connected to the first port of the PD control module, and the third port of the first female seat is connected to the first port of the DC-DC module. Port connection, the fourth port of the first female seat is connected to the PD power supply module, and the fifth port of the first female seat is connected to the first port of the Bypass circuit;
